(******************************************************************************)
(* *)
(* Author : Uwe Schächterle (Corpsman) *)
(* *)
(* This file is part of FPC_Atomic *)
(* *)
(* See the file license.md, located under: *)
(* https://github.com/PascalCorpsman/Software_Licenses/blob/main/license.md *)
(* for details about the license. *)
(* *)
(* It is not allowed to change or remove this text from any *)
(* source file of the project. *)
(* *)
(******************************************************************************)
Unit uatomic_statistics;
{$MODE ObjFPC}{$H+}
Interface
Uses
Classes, SysUtils, uatomic_common;
Type
(*
* Alles worüber der Server so Statistiken führt ;)
*)
TStatSelector = (
ssMatchesStarted
, ssGamesStarted
, ssFramesRendered
, ssBombsDropped
, ssPowerupsCollected
, ssPlayerDeaths
, ssBricksDestroyed
, ssPowerupDestroyed
, ssTotalNetworkBytesIn // UDP-Daten werden Ignoriert
, ssTotalNetworkBytesOut // UDP-Daten werden Ignoriert
, ssTotalNetworkPacketsIn // UDP-Daten werden Ignoriert
, ssTotalNetworkPacketsOut // UDP-Daten werden Ignoriert
);
TStatisticCallback = Procedure(StatSelector: TStatSelector; Value: uint64 = 1) Of Object;
TGameStatistik = Record
Total: Array[TStatSelector] Of UInt64;
LastRun: Array[TStatSelector] Of UInt64;
End;
TPlayerStatSelector = (
pssKills // -- Fertig
, pssFriendlyFireKills // -- Fertig -- dazu zählen auch Selbstkills
, pssDeaths // -- Fertig
, pssPlayedMatches // -- Fertig
, pssWonMatches // -- Fertig
, pssPlayedRounds // -- Fertig
, pssWonRounds // -- Fertig
, pssDrawRounds // -- Fertig
, pssPlacedBombs // -- Fertig
, pssTriggeredBombs // -- Fertig -- Mit dem BombenTrigger
, pssThrownBombs // -- Fertig -- Mit dem Blauen Handschuh
, pssPushedBombs // -- Fertig -- Mit dem Roten Handschuh
, pssSpoogedBombs // -- Fertig -- Mit dem Spooger auf einmal gelegt
, pssKickedBombs // -- Fertig -- Mit dem Kicker PowerUp
, pssBricksDestroyed // -- Fertig
, pssPowerupsCollected // -- Fertig
, pssPowerupsDestroyed // -- Fertig
, pssDiseased // -- Fertig -- Anzahl der Krankheiten die ein Spieler bekommen hat
, pssDiseaseSpread // -- Fertig -- Anzahl der "Ansteckungen" die ein Spieler an andere übergeben hat
);
TPlayerStatSelectorCounts = Array[TPlayerStatSelector] Of uint64;
TPlayerStatistics = Record
UserName: String;
KeySet: TKeySet;
stats: TPlayerStatSelectorCounts;
End;
TPlayerStatisticCallback = Procedure(PlayerIndex: Integer; StatSelector: TPlayerStatSelector; Value: uint64 = 1) Of Object;
{ TPlayerStatisticEngine }
TPlayerStatisticEngine = Class
private
fPlayerStatistics: Array Of TPlayerStatistics;
fIndexMapper: Array Of Integer; // Wandelt die Server Indexe um in die fPlayerStatistics Indexe
public
Constructor Create; virtual;
Destructor Destroy; override;
Procedure LoadPlayerStatistics(Const aFilename: String);
Procedure SavePlayerStatistics(Const aFilename: String);
Procedure ResetPlayerIDs; // Setzt ALle Aktuellen "Zuordungen zurück
// Initialisiert alles Notwendige um via Index auf die Interne Struktur zugreifen zu können
// Wird zu begin eines Matches aufgrufen
// -> Match Counter ++
Procedure InitPlayerID(
Index: integer; // Index, den der Server für Alle Callbacks übergeben wird
UserName: String; // Zur Identifizierung des Spielers
KeySet: TKeySet // Zur Identifizierung des Spielers
);
// Verändert den übergebenen StatSelector um Value
Procedure UpdatePlayerID(
Index: Integer; // Index, den der Server für Alle Callbacks übergeben wird
StatSelector: TPlayerStatSelector;
Value: uint64 = 1);
End;
Implementation
Uses uatomic_global;
Function PlayerStatSelectorToString(aValue: TPlayerStatSelector): String;
Begin
result := '';
Case aValue Of
pssKills: result := 'Kills';
pssFriendlyFireKills: result := 'Friendly fire kills';
pssDeaths: result := 'Deaths';
pssPlayedMatches: result := 'Played Matches';
pssWonMatches: result := 'Matches won';
pssPlayedRounds: result := 'Played rounds';
pssWonRounds: result := 'Rounds won';
pssDrawRounds: result := 'Draw rounds';
pssPlacedBombs: result := 'Placed bombs';
pssTriggeredBombs: result := 'Triggered bombs';
pssThrownBombs: result := 'Thrown bombs';
pssPushedBombs: result := 'Pushed bombs';
pssSpoogedBombs: result := 'Spooged bombs';
pssKickedBombs: result := 'Kicked bombs';
pssBricksDestroyed: result := 'Bricks destroyed';
pssPowerupsCollected: result := 'Power-up collected';
pssPowerupsDestroyed: result := 'Power-up destroyed';
pssDiseased: result := 'Diseased';
pssDiseaseSpread: result := 'Disease spread';
Else Begin
Raise exception.Create('Error: PlayerStatSelectorToString, missing implementation.');
End;
End;
End;
{ TPlayerStatisticEngine }
Constructor TPlayerStatisticEngine.Create;
Begin
Inherited Create;
fPlayerStatistics := Nil;
fIndexMapper := Nil;
End;
Destructor TPlayerStatisticEngine.Destroy;
Begin
SetLength(fPlayerStatistics, 0);
SetLength(fIndexMapper, 0);
End;
Procedure TPlayerStatisticEngine.LoadPlayerStatistics(Const aFilename: String);
Var
sl: TStringList;
tmp, players: TStringArray;
i, k, EnterID: Integer;
j: TPlayerStatSelector;
s: String;
Begin
EnterID := LogEnter('TPlayerStatisticEngine.LoadPlayerStatistics');
If Not FileExists(aFilename) Then Begin
LogLeave(EnterID);
exit;
End;
sl := TStringList.Create;
sl.LoadFromFile(aFilename);
If (sl.Count = 0) Or (trim(sl[0]) = '') Then Begin
sl.free;
LogLeave(EnterID);
exit;
End;
players := trim(sl[0]).Split(#9);
setlength(fPlayerStatistics, length(players));
For i := 0 To high(players) Do Begin
tmp := players[i].Split(';');
If length(tmp) >= 2 Then Begin
fPlayerStatistics[i].UserName := tmp[0];
fPlayerStatistics[i].KeySet := StringToKeySet(tmp[1]);
End
Else Begin
fPlayerStatistics[i].UserName := 'Invalid';
fPlayerStatistics[i].KeySet := ks0;
log(players[i] + ' invalid username / keyset', llError);
End;
// Reset alles zu 0
FillChar(fPlayerStatistics[i].stats, sizeof(fPlayerStatistics[i].stats), 0);
End;
For i := 1 To sl.Count - 1 Do Begin
tmp := trim(sl[i]).Split(#9);
// Ja das ist Umständlich aber dafür "robust"
If length(tmp) <> length(fPlayerStatistics) + 1 Then Begin
log('Drop invalid line: ' + sl[i], llWarning);
Continue;
End;
For j In TPlayerStatSelector Do Begin
s := PlayerStatSelectorToString(j);
If tmp[0] = s Then Begin
For k := 0 To high(fPlayerStatistics) Do Begin
fPlayerStatistics[k].stats[j] := StrToInt64Def(tmp[k + 1], 0);
End;
break;
End;
End;
End;
sl.free;
LogLeave(EnterID);
End;
Procedure TPlayerStatisticEngine.SavePlayerStatistics(Const aFilename: String);
Var
sl: TStringList;
s: String;
i: Integer;
j: TPlayerStatSelector;
Begin
sl := TStringList.Create;
// Die Header Zeile
s := #9;
For i := 0 To high(fPlayerStatistics) Do Begin
s := s + fPlayerStatistics[i].UserName + ';' + KeySetToString(fPlayerStatistics[i].KeySet) + #9;
End;
sl.Add(s);
// Der Eigentliche Inhalt ;)
For j In TPlayerStatSelector Do Begin
s := PlayerStatSelectorToString(j) + #9;
For i := 0 To high(fPlayerStatistics) Do Begin
s := s + IntToStr(fPlayerStatistics[i].stats[j]) + #9;
End;
sl.Add(s);
End;
sl.SaveToFile(aFilename);
sl.free;
End;
Procedure TPlayerStatisticEngine.ResetPlayerIDs;
Begin
setlength(fIndexMapper, 0);
End;
Procedure TPlayerStatisticEngine.InitPlayerID(Index: integer; UserName: String;
KeySet: TKeySet);
Var
ol, i, Localindex: Integer;
Var
EnterID: Integer;
Begin
EnterID := LogEnter('TPlayerStatisticEngine.AssignPlayerID');
// Löschen Verbotener Zeichen, man weis ja nie was spieler sich für namen ausdenken ..
username := StringReplace(UserName, #9, '', [rfReplaceAll]);
username := StringReplace(UserName, ';', '', [rfReplaceAll]);
Log(format('Username: %s, KeySet %s', [UserName, KeySetToString(KeySet)]), lldebug);
Localindex := -1;
// Den Index bestimmen, auf welchem der Spieler getrackt wird ..
For i := 0 To high(fPlayerStatistics) Do Begin
If (fPlayerStatistics[i].UserName = UserName) And
(fPlayerStatistics[i].KeySet = KeySet) Then Begin
Localindex := i;
break;
End;
End;
If Localindex = -1 Then Begin
setlength(fPlayerStatistics, high(fPlayerStatistics) + 2);
fPlayerStatistics[high(fPlayerStatistics)].UserName := UserName;
fPlayerStatistics[high(fPlayerStatistics)].KeySet := KeySet;
FillChar(fPlayerStatistics[high(fPlayerStatistics)].stats, sizeof(fPlayerStatistics[high(fPlayerStatistics)].stats), 0);
Localindex := high(fPlayerStatistics);
End;
// Hochzählen der Gestarteten Matches
inc(fPlayerStatistics[Localindex].stats[pssPlayedMatches]);
// Abspeichern des Mappings
If index > high(fIndexMapper) Then Begin
ol := length(fIndexMapper);
setlength(fIndexMapper, index + 1);
For i := ol To high(fIndexMapper) Do
fIndexMapper[i] := -1;
End;
fIndexMapper[Index] := Localindex;
LogLeave(EnterID);
End;
Procedure TPlayerStatisticEngine.UpdatePlayerID(Index: Integer;
StatSelector: TPlayerStatSelector; Value: uint64);
Var
EnterID: Integer;
Begin
EnterID := LogEnter('TPlayerStatisticEngine.UpdatePlayerID');
If (index > high(fIndexMapper)) Then Begin
log('Invalid index ' + IntToStr(Index), llFatal);
LogLeave(EnterID);
exit;
End;
If (fIndexMapper[index] < 0) Or (fIndexMapper[index] > high(fPlayerStatistics)) Then Begin
log('Invalid mapped index ' + IntToStr(fIndexMapper[index]), llFatal);
LogLeave(EnterID);
exit;
End;
inc(fPlayerStatistics[fIndexMapper[Index]].stats[StatSelector], Value);
LogLeave(EnterID);
End;
End.
